Men's Tennis

Titans Edge IPFW

Box Score

Led by junior Pjotrs Necajevs ((Riga, Latvia/Herdera Vidusskola) and freshman Dustin Goldenberg (Bloomfield Hills, MI/West Bloomfield), the UDM men's tennis team won its third straight match as the Titans upended IPFW, 4-3, on Friday night at the Pine Ridge Racquet and Fitness Center.

The top Titan doubles tandem, Necajevs and Goldenberg started the Titans off with an 8-6 victory in team play. With an 8-6 win at No. 2 doubles by freshmen Gino McCathney (Livonia, MI/Stevenson) and David Stabley (Utica, MI/Eisenhower), Detroit jumped on the Mastodons with the early doubles point that proved to be the match winner.

Necajevs and Goldenberg then posted two singles triumphs as Necajevs easily won his match 6-1, 6-3, while the rookie Goldenberg took his 7-6 (3), 6-0. Stabley then came up with a win at No. 4 singles, rebounding from a 6-1 loss in set one to take the next two 7-6 (4), 6-4.

Detroit will stay in Fort Wayne to take on St. Francis (PA) on Saturday. Match time is set for 2:00 p.m.
